He asked that <br />the affected residents be notified prior to the August 11 meeting if the issue can be <br />resolved. <br />Khosrow Daivar, 1082 Loma Linda, informed the Council he had added a screened in <br />area on his deck and the work was stopped by the building inspector, who informed him <br />of the need for a building permit and a variance from the average lakeshore setback <br />requirement. The screened area is complete except for painting. Daivar said his <br />property is on a peninsula. Daivar said he spoke with Van Zomeren of the need to make <br />an application for a variance and provide a survey of the property. Daivar feels the law <br />is should be changed. He indicated he feels he has a hardship regarding the screened area. <br />Jabbour informed Daivar that only the building inspector can make the determination <br />regarding the need for a building permit. <br />Barrett agreed that a building permit cannot be waived, but if denied, it can be appealed <br />to the Council. <br />Daivar voiced his concern with the cost of the application. He feels the process is a <br />hardship. <br />Jabbour noted the purpose of the law and his support of it. <br />Goetten reiterated that the work was begun without obtaining a permit, and Daivar was <br />notified of his need for a variance. <br />Daivar said he did not think he needed to have a building permit. <br />3 <br />11 <br />
